  • Hello @fredadam & @FredLaFA,

    You could use cues to do so.

    For info, when Millumin has the option "go to next board" (see Preferences) activated, once it reaches the end of a board, it goes to the next one, first column.

    Best. Philippe

  • Hi Philippe, oh yes i created a custom auto Go with an internal signal (within a Timeline segment) calling a cue to go back to a specific column of another board and it works like a charm! In that way we can control what column we want to load from another board with such a kind of programming.
